Как подключить SQLite: простое руководство для начинающих
Чтобы подключить SQLite, вам потребуется выполнить следующие шаги:
- Скачайте и установите SQLite с официального сайта: https://www.sqlite.org/download.html
- После установки SQLite, создайте новый файл с расширением ".db" (например, "mydatabase.db"). Этот файл будет служить базой данных SQLite.
- Откройте терминал или командную строку и перейдите в папку, где находится установленный SQLite.
- Введите следующую команду, чтобы подключиться к базе данных:
sqlite3 mydatabase.db
Здесь "mydatabase.db" - это имя вашего файла базы данных. Если файл находится в другой папке, укажите полный путь к файлу.
Теперь вы подключены к базе данных SQLite и можете выполнять запросы и операции с данными.
Детальный ответ
Как подключить SQLite
SQLite является компактной и легковесной реляционной базой данных, которую можно использовать во многих приложениях. Она широко применяется для хранения данных на мобильных устройствах и разработке небольших проектов. В этой статье мы рассмотрим, как подключить SQLite к своим проектам.
1. Шаг 1: Установка SQLite
Первым шагом является установка SQLite на вашу систему. SQLite предоставляет библиотеку и утилиты командной строки для работы с базой данных. Вы можете скачать соответствующую версию SQLite для вашей операционной системы с официального веб-сайта SQLite: https://www.sqlite.org/download.html. Установщик SQLite обычно включает инструкции по установке, следуйте им для завершения установки.
2. Шаг 2: Подключение к базе данных в приложении
После установки SQLite вы можете начать использовать его в своих приложениях. Шаги, необходимые для подключения к базе данных SQLite, зависят от языка программирования или фреймворка, с которым вы работаете.
A. Язык программирования Python
Если вы планируете использовать Python для работы с базой данных SQLite, вам потребуется установить модуль SQLite для Python. Вы можете установить его с помощью пакетного менеджера pip с помощью следующей команды:
pip install pysqlite3
После установки модуля SQLite для Python, вы можете подключиться к базе данных SQLite в своем приложении с использованием следующего кода:
import sqlite3
# Подключение к базе данных SQLite
connection = sqlite3.connect('database.db')
B. Язык программирования Java
Если вы работаете с языком программирования Java, вам потребуется подключиться к базе данных SQLite с помощью JDBC (Java Database Connectivity). Для начала убедитесь, что у вас установлена Java Development Kit (JDK). Затем вам необходимо добавить JDBC драйвер SQLite в ваш проект. Вы можете найти JDBC драйвер SQLite на веб-сайте SQLite по адресу: https://www.sqlite.org/download.html. Следуйте инструкциям по установке драйвера.
После установки JDBC драйвера SQLite, вы можете использовать следующий код для подключения к базе данных SQLite в своем приложении:
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
public class Main {
public static void main(String[] args) {
// Подключение к базе данных SQLite
try {
Connection connection = DriverManager.getConnection("jdbc:sqlite:database.db");
} catch (SQLException e) {
e.printStackTrace();
}
}
}
C. Язык программирования JavaScript (с использованием Node.js)
Если вы разрабатываете приложения на JavaScript с использованием Node.js, вы можете использовать модуль SQLite для Node.js, такой как "sqlite3". Для установки модуля SQLite вам потребуется установить его с помощью пакетного менеджера npm с использованием следующей команды:
npm install sqlite3
После установки модуля SQLite для Node.js, вы можете подключиться к базе данных SQLite в своем приложении с использованием следующего кода:
const sqlite3 = require('sqlite3').verbose();
// Подключение к базе данных SQLite
let db = new sqlite3.Database('database.db');
3. Шаг 3: Создание и использование базы данных SQLite
После подключения к базе данных SQLite, вы можете создавать таблицы, выполнять запросы и манипулировать данными в базе данных. Рассмотрим пример создания простой таблицы "users" с двумя столбцами "id" и "name" и вставки данных в нее:
A. Язык программирования Python
import sqlite3
# Подключение к базе данных SQLite
connection = sqlite3.connect('database.db')
# Создание таблицы
cursor = connection.cursor()
cursor.execute("CREATE TABLE IF NOT EXISTS users (id INTEGER PRIMARY KEY, name TEXT)")
# Вставка данных
cursor.execute("INSERT INTO users (name) VALUES ('John')")
connection.commit()
# Закрытие соединения
connection.close()
B. Язык программирования Java
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
import java.sql.Statement;
public class Main {
public static void main(String[] args) {
// Подключение к базе данных SQLite
try {
Connection connection = DriverManager.getConnection("jdbc:sqlite:database.db");
// Создание таблицы
Statement statement = connection.createStatement();
String createTableQuery = "CREATE TABLE IF NOT EXISTS users (id INTEGER PRIMARY KEY, name TEXT)";
statement.execute(createTableQuery);
// Вставка данных
String insertDataQuery = "INSERT INTO users (name) VALUES ('John')";
statement.execute(insertDataQuery);
// Закрытие соединения
connection.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
}
C. Язык программирования JavaScript (с использованием Node.js)
const sqlite3 = require('sqlite3').verbose();
// Подключение к базе данных SQLite
let db = new sqlite3.Database('database.db');
// Создание таблицы
db.run("CREATE TABLE IF NOT EXISTS users (id INTEGER PRIMARY KEY, name TEXT)");
// Вставка данных
db.run("INSERT INTO users (name) VALUES ('John')");
// Закрытие соединения
db.close();
Заключение
В этой статье мы рассмотрели, как подключить SQLite к своим проектам. Независимо от того, какой язык программирования вы используете, вам потребуется установить соответствующий драйвер или модуль для работы с базой данных SQLite. После подключения к базе данных вы сможете создавать таблицы, выполнять запросы и манипулировать данными. SQLite предоставляет простой и удобный способ работы с реляционными данными, что делает его отличным выбором для небольших проектов и приложений.